This study characterizes the mineral content of vinegar samples.The concentrations of Na, K, Ca, MULTIFACTORS WOMEN Mg and P (major elements) as well as Fe, Mn, Sn, Cu, Ni, Zn, Pb and Cd (minor elements) were determined in 35 commercial vinegar samples using inductively coupled plasma optical-emission spectrometry (ICP-OES).The elements with the highest concentrations were K, Queen Na, Ca, Mg and P.
The concentrations of heavy metals in the vinegar samples, including Cd, Ni, Sn and Pb, were not considered a health risk.
